Schizophrenia places an incredible burden on patients, families, communities, and governments, therefore intense efforts to find therapeutic responses to this illness continue. The traditional antipsychotics were discovered by chance, the atypical antipsychotics were configured to preserve "what worked" while adding and eliminating important effects, and the next generation continues to evolve in an attempt to improve on previous generations. Aripiprazole is extoled as a new generation of antipsychotic drugs. Information to date suggests it is an effective antipsychotic with a remarkable side effect profile. We are hopeful this drug will provide a relief for the suffering associated with schizophrenia.
